在Excel的数据处理过程中,经常会遇到需要从文本字符串中提取特定部分内容的情况。比如处理由工号和姓名连接在一起的文本数据时,LEFT、RIGHT、MID这三个函数就如同得力助手,能帮助我们快速准确地提取出所需信息。下面,就让我们深入了解一下这三个函数的具体用法。

一、LEFT函数

LEFT函数的作用是从文本字符串的左侧开始提取指定数量的字符。其语法为LEFT(text,[num_chars]),其中:

  • text:必需参数,代表要提取字符的文本字符串,可以是直接输入的文本内容,也可以是单元格引用。
  • [num_chars]:可选参数,指定要从文本左侧提取的字符数量。如果省略该参数,则默认提取 1 个字符。

例如,公式=LEFT(A2,6)表示从A2元格的文本字符串左侧开始,提取6个字符。在工号固定为6位且文本是工号 - 姓名连接的情况下,这个公式就能轻松提取出工号。

Excel文本处理:LEFT、RIGHT、MID函数的巧妙运用-趣帮office教程网

二、RIGHT函数

RIGHT函数与LEFT函数相对,是从文本字符串的右侧开始提取指定数量的字符。语法为RIGHT(text,[num_chars]) ,参数含义与LEFT函数类似。

当我们想从数据文本的右侧提取固定位数(如6位)的工号时,使用公式=RIGHT(A2,6)即可。

Excel文本处理:LEFT、RIGHT、MID函数的巧妙运用-趣帮office教程网

三、MID函数

MID函数的功能是从文本字符串中指定的起始位置开始,提取指定数量的字符。语法为MID(text,start_num,num_chars),其中:

  • text:必需参数,即要提取字符的文本字符串。
  • start_num:必需参数,指定从文本的第几位开始提取字符,起始位置从 1 开始计数。
  • num_chars:必需参数,指定要提取的字符数量。

在处理姓名提取的问题上,由于姓名的位数不固定(可能是2位或3位等),但知道姓名在文本中的起始位置和大致的字符数量范围,所以可以使用MID函数。例如公式=MID(A2,7,4),表示从A2单元格文本的第 7 位开始,提取4位字符。如果后面不足4位字符,就会提取实际存在的字符数量,从而成功提取出姓名。

Excel文本处理:LEFT、RIGHT、MID函数的巧妙运用-趣帮office教程网

四、应用场景举例

场景1、员工信息管理

在员工信息表中,员工编号和姓名可能存储在一个单元格中。通过使用这三个函数,可以快速将员工编号和姓名分别提取到不同的单元格中,方便数据的整理和分析。

场景2、商品编码处理

商品编码和名称可能连接在一起,利用这些函数可以准确提取出商品编码或名称,便于库存管理、销售统计等工作。

掌握LEFT、RIGHT、MID函数的使用方法,能让我们在Excel文本处理中更加游刃有余,提高数据处理的效率和准确性。无论是简单的数据提取还是复杂的文本分析,这三个函数都能发挥重要作用。